In the field of corrosion engineering and cathodic protection, Sacrificial Anodes systems are commonly used. Sacrificial anodes, more electrochemically active than the metals they protect, undergo corrosion preferentially when electrically connected to the structure. This principle of galvanic corrosion protection is a cornerstone of corrosion engineering. However, this Process has typically been a passive system.…

Should it be necessary to test the reference electrode prior to installation, it is important not to pre-test the electrode in a bucket of water as in most cases this will void the warranty.
